Basu Chatterjee Biography

Basu Chatterjee is a Bengali director who has given significant contributions to Bollywood as well. He is most known to stories related to middle classes and in many scenarios he resembles Hrishikeh Mukherjee a lot. His most popular Bollywood movies include – Ragniganda, Piya ka ghar, Do Ladke Dono Kadke, Swami, Manzil, Chakravyooh, Jeena yahan, Dillagi, Ek ruka hua faisla, Chameli ki shaadi, Sheesha, Shaukeen, Man pasand, Pasand apna apna, Khatta meeta, Hamari bahu Alka, Chitchor and Choti si baat.  He has also acted as a dialogue writer, screenplay writer as well as producer for many successful movies. Actor Amol Palekar became immensely popular through his movies Ragniganda, Chitchor and Choti si baat.  He has also used veteran singer Yesudas’ voice to sing many songs for Amol Palekar and still remembered as Yesudas’ best Bollywood songs. Yesudas debut Bollywood through Chitchor, singing for Amol Palekar, won National awards as well. Teena Munim has also worked in a few movies like Man pasand, Batom batom mein etc. His daughter Rupali Guha is also a film director and has directed several television serials as well. His Bengali films include - Hochheta Ki, Trishanku, Tak Jhal Mishti, Chupi Chupi and Hothat Brishti.

 

Basu Chatterjee was born in Ajmer, Rajasthan in the year 1930. He joined industry as an assistant director during late 1960’s.  He has become a part of many critically well accalimed movies of 60’s like Teesri kasam and Saraswathi Chandra. He switched on to direction with Sara Akash in the year 1969. This movie was regarded as one among those Indian movies that started Indian new wave. This movie starring Rakesh Pandey, Madhu Chakravarty, Nandita Thakur and A.K.Hangal in the leading roles received national award for cinematography as well. This black and white movie was the debut work of K.K.Mahajan. Basu Chatterjee was the screenplay writer and producer of the movie along with direction as well.

 

Then it took 5 years to direct next movie – Ragnigandha. His movies are always remembered for excellent camera work, realistic actors as well as realistic stories that seem like next door incident. Each and every movie of Basu Chatterjee has a distinct finger mark of his own. He has directed a few television serials and has directed a few movies also. He has won best screenplay writer award in Filmfare thrice for Sara Akash, Choti si baat and Kamla ki maut. He has won Filmfare Critics Award for Best Movie twice - Jeena Yahan and Ragniganda. He has won best director award at Filmfare for the movie ‘Swami’ as well.
